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/politie/breeze-kickstarter
Kickstarter for Breeze (Spring integration for Apache Storm)
https://github.com/politie/breeze-kickstarter
Last synced: 1 day ago
JSON representation
Kickstarter for Breeze (Spring integration for Apache Storm)
- Host: GitHub
- URL: https://github.com/politie/breeze-kickstarter
- Owner: politie
- License: apache-2.0
- Created: 2013-12-12T13:43:56.000Z (almost 11 years ago)
- Default Branch: master
- Last Pushed: 2015-11-19T08:16:54.000Z (about 9 years ago)
- Last Synced: 2024-03-27T13:13:10.972Z (8 months ago)
- Language: Java
- Homepage:
- Size: 30.3 KB
- Stars: 3
- Watchers: 5
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
- License: LICENSE
Awesome Lists containing this project
README
[Breeze](https://github.com/internet-research-network/breeze) Kickstarter
-------------------------------------------------------------------------The Maven Exec plugin runs the demo in local mode.
```shell
$ mvn package exec:java
```The storm command deploys the [demo context](https://github.com/internet-research-network/breeze-kickstarter/blob/master/src/main/resources/applicationContext.xml) on a cluster.
```shell
$ storm jar breeze-kickstarter-1.0-SNAPSHOT.jar eu.icolumbo.breeze.namespace.TopologyStarter demo
```How It Works
============The topology starters use Spring enabled [spout](https://github.com/internet-research-network/breeze/blob/master/src/main/java/eu/icolumbo/breeze/SpringSpout.java) and [bolt](https://github.com/internet-research-network/breeze/blob/master/src/main/java/eu/icolumbo/breeze/SpringBolt.java) Storm components to use the [topology appliction context](https://github.com/internet-research-network/breeze-kickstarter/blob/master/src/main/resources/demo-context.xml).
Note that the Marker bean will be instantiated for each call due to the prototype scope.